@dr.jimholtz3 ай бұрын
I will tell you that Ground Clear will wash into the surrounding area, especially if it’s not flat. I sprayed for weeds in areas where I have mulch and rocks, and because of the grade, the Ground Clear washed into my grass and has killed it. Unfortunately I’ll have to wait until next year to plant new seed. I didn’t expect that it would wash that much once dry, so don’t spray too heavily, or play it safe and use Roundup instead of Ground Clear in areas that you are worried about runoff.

At Tractor Supply, 1 Gal of Ortho is $30.00 & 1 Gal of RM43 is $80.00. Ortho requires 24 Oz per Gal of water, while RM43 requires 6 Oz per Gal of water. 1 Gal of Ortho makes 5.3 Gals of sprayable product, while 1 Gal RM43 makes 21.3 Gals of sprayable product. This equals $5.67 per sprayable Gal of the Ortho vs $3.75 per sprayable Gal of RM43. They both kill all vegetation a long time. I have used both and stuck with RM43 because the savings adds up over time.

I might add that the 2 gallon jug of ortho should be considered if using against the rm43 in terms of vale. It's 49.99 on Amazon, which brings it down to $25/gallon instead of $30. This makes it $3.94/usable gallon of spray for ortho, which is almost equal to rm43 @ $3.75/gallon. My Math: 256 ounces of ortho (2gal)/24 (ounces that you add to 1 gallon of water) makes 10.66 "batches". Each batch is 1.19 gallon (1 gallon water with 24oz groundclear). So, 10.66*1.19=12.68 gallons of sprayable solution solution. $50/12.68= $3.94 per gallon of sprayable solution. I get what Ground clear is for. But what about the others concentrates you showed?
@HandymanHertz5 ай бұрын
2,4-D: kills broadleaf weeds but does not kill grass. Roundup/grass and weed killer: kills all grass and broadleaf weeds, but there's no residual or carryover herbicide left in the ground. It will kill everything, but weeds can germinate and grow in that ground.
